OF YOUR BOUNTY.

AID FOR FAMINE-STRICKKN JAPANESE. ASSISTANCE FROM N.Z. GOVERNMENT. CONTRIBUTION TO 'FRISCO RELIEF. PEE PBBSB ASSOCIATION. Wellington, May 1. On making inquiries the New Zealand Governmentias ascertained that, the famine in Japan and the hardships endured by the people, are more sever* than was at first thought to be the case, Tho Japanese Government having intimated that the effects of the famine were under estimated, and that it was prepared to receive assistance, the New Zealand Government has forwarded £IOOO as a contribution from this Colony for the relief of the suffering.

Mr Seddon has received the following communication through the Secretary of State for the Colonies " Referring to your telegram respecting the San Franciso disaster, the following has been received from His Majesty's Ambassador at Washington: "The President desires me to express to the Government and people of New Zealand his deep appreciation of their sympathy. He feels sure that they will understand the people of the United States are none the less grateful because it lias been decided that it will be unnecessary to accept help from outside." Under these circumstances the New Zealand Government has decided to send to the New Zealand Agent at San Francisco the sum of five thousand dollars (£1250) for expenditure in the relief of suffering, and to ensuro comforts for New Zealandcrs in San Francisco who may have suffered by the disaster.
